Αναμείνατε ολίγον τι
Τεχνολογία

Ο εφευρέτης των κωδικών πρόσβασης έκανε … logout

Fernando Corbato

Η ασφάλεια των υπολογιστών και η κυβερνοασφάλεια είναι τομείς που μας βοηθούν καθημερινά αλλά δεν αντιλαμβανόμαστε ότι είναι εκεί.

Είναι οι σιωπηλοί μας φίλοι που μας προστατεύουν σε κάθε μας κίνηση στο διαδίκτυο. Άνθρωποι που γίνονται ολοένα και πιο αναγκαίοι αφού συνδέονται ολοένα και περισσότερες “έξυπνες” συσκευές, είτε smartphones, είτε τηλεοράσεις, ή ακόμα και ολόκληρα σπίτια, σε αυτό που ονομάζεται «Internet of things«.

Την ύπαρξη τους και τις ικανότητες τους τις χρωστάμε σε μία ομάδα αγνώστων ηρώων που έχουν δουλέψει σκληρά για να κάνουν τον κυβερνοχώρο ένα πιο ασφαλές περιβάλλον.

Ένας από τους πρωτοπόρους και θεμελιωτές του τομέα, είναι ο Fernando «Corby» Corbato. Σε αυτόν τον άνθρωπο οφείλουμε την δημιουργία του κωδικού πρόσβασης / συνθηματικού (password).

Δυστυχώς όμως, ο κόσμος της  ψηφιακής ασφάλειας υπέστη ένα μεγάλο πλήγμα, αφού ο Corbato απεβίωσε πρόσφατα, σε ηλικία 93 ετών – την Παρασκευή 12 Ιουλίου 2019, από κάποιες επιπλοκές που του προκάλεσε ο διαβήτης.

Ήταν καθηγητής του Massachusetts Institute of Technology, του γνωστού σε όλους MIT, και επινόησε την βασική ιδέα του μηχανισμού των λογαριασμών χρηστών (user accounts), οι οποίοι προστατεύονται από κωδικούς πρόσβασης/συνθηματικά (passwords).

Η παραπάνω ιδέα σχηματίστηκε ταυτόχρονα με την καθιέρωση του Compatible Time-Sharing System που επέτρεψε σε πολλαπλούς χρήστες να χρησιμοποιήσουν έναν υπολογιστή ταυτόχρονα.

Όπως είχε δηλώσει και ίδιος σε συνέντευξη του στο Wall Street Journal, ήταν θέμα καθιέρωσης της “τμηματοποίησης” (compartmentalization) και των βασικών αρχών ιδιωτικότητας. Η κίνηση αυτή βοήθησε στην συνέχεια στον σχηματισμό της ψηφιακής ασφάλειας.

Η ιστορία του βέβαια στο συγκεκριμένο ανώτατο ίδρυμα ξεκίνησε πολύ πιο νωρίς. Η σχέση τους ξεκίνησε το 1950, όταν αποφάσισε να αποκτήσει ένα διδακτορικό στην Φυσική. Σύντομα όμως ανακάλυψε ότι τα μηχανήματα που χρησιμοποιούσαν οι φυσικοί για τους υπολογισμούς τους, τον ενδιέφεραν πολύ περισσότερο.

Όπως φαντάζεστε, οι υπολογιστές στην δεκαετία του 1950 ήταν αρκετά “πρωτόγονοι” σε σχέση με τα σημερινά δεδομένα. Ήταν τεράστιες συσκευές που μπορούσαν να εκτελέσουν μόνο μία διεργασία κάθε φορά, και ήταν μία διαδικασία που εκνεύριζε αρκετό κόσμο.

 

Κάπου σε αυτό το σημείο μπήκε σε λειτουργία η ευστροφία του Corbató και έδωσε λύση σε αυτό το πρόβλημα που δυσκόλευε τον τότε επιστημονικό κόσμο.

 

 

Δεν θα σταθούμε όμως μόνο σε αυτό του το επίτευγμα. Η δημιουργία και η καθιέρωση του μοντέλου CTSS, μείωσε τον χρόνο αναμονής των χρηστών για την χρήση ενός υπολογιστή από μερικές ώρες σε δευτερόλεπτα!

Μετά από αυτό, οι υπολογιστές μπορεί να ήταν λίγοι αλλά έγιναν πιο εύχρηστοι και πιο προσιτοί. Μπορεί να μιλάμε για την “αρχαιότητα” στον κόσμο των υπολογιστών, αλλά ακόμα και τα μηχανήματα της δεκαετίας του 50 και του 60 είχαν αρκετή υπολογιστική ισχύ ώστε να μην είναι ορατό στους χρήστες ότι τους έχει κατανεμηθεί μόνο ένα τμήμα της.

Από την άλλη, το Multics time-sharing system που είχε δημιουργήσει έθετε τα θεμέλια για την κατασκευή των μελλοντικών λειτουργικών συστημάτων όπως το Linux. Τέτοια λειτουργικά είχαν πιο λεπτομερείς ρυθμίσεις για την ιδιωτικότητα, ιεραρχημένα συστήματα αρχείων και άλλα χαρακτηριστικά που στην σημερινή εποχή θεωρούνται δεδομένα.

Ήταν επίσης υπεύθυνος για τον Νόμο του Corbato (Corbato’s Law), ο οποίος ορίζει πως οι προγραμματιστές γράφουν το ίδιο πλήθος γραμμών κώδικα ανεξάρτητα από την γλώσσα στην οποία γράφουν.

Υποστήριξε επίσης ότι με το να γράφουν σε γλώσσες υψηλού επιπέδου (higher-level languages) αντί για γλώσσες κοντά στην μηχανή (close-to-the-metal) καταλήγουν να σπαταλούν περισσότερο χρόνο για να γράψουν αυτό που θέλουν.

Επίσης, το 1990 του απονεμήθηκε το βραβείο AM Turing Award για την πρωτοποριακή δουλειά του στα συστήματα κατανεμημένου χρόνου (time-sharing systems). Το βραβείο Turing είναι ένα από τα υψηλότερα και πιο διάσημα βραβεία που απονέμονται στους επιστήμονες υπολογιστών.

Τα τελευταία χρόνια όμως αντιλήφθηκε ότι η χρήση των συνθηματικών είχε και κάποια προβλήματα. Ο κόσμος του διαδικτύου έκανε τα logins έναν “εφιάλτη”.

Ο κόσμος του internet όμως μεταβάλλεται ραγδαία και κάνει προσπάθειες ώστε να απομακρυνθεί από την χρήση των συνθηματικών, έτσι ώστε να εξαλείψει την υποκλοπή λογαριασμών και να κάνει τα πράγματα ευκολότερα για όλους.

Ακόμα και όταν φτάσουμε σε αυτό το σημείο, κανείς δεν θα μπορεί να αρνηθεί την τεράστια αξία που είχε το έργο αυτού του ανθρώπου και το πως θεμελίωσε τον τομέα της ψηφιακής ασφάλειας.

Πηγές

Μοιραστείτε το άρθρο

The following two tabs change content below.
agathan

agathan

Αποφοίτησα απο το τμήμα Εφαρμοσμένων Μαθηματικών του Πανεπιστημίου Κρήτης. Κάτα την διάρκεια εργάστηκα στην τεχνική υποστήριξη του τμήματος. Ακολούθησε το μεταπτυχιακό μου, Msc In Applied Mathematics at University Of Delaware. Ύστερα δούλεψα για μερικά χρόνια σαν web developer (CMS and what not) και SEO/Google Ads engineer.
Και τώρα είμαστε στο GeekD, μια λέξη που περιγράφει όλα τα παραπάνω.

"All we have to decide is what to do with the time that is given us."
-Gandalf The Grey, JRR Tolkien

Αφήστε ένα σχόλιο

Επιλογές της ομάδας
σκίτσο του Άλμπερτ Αϊνστάιν
Πώς τα μυστικά των πρώτων αριθμών κάνουν τον κόσμο μας ασφαλέστερο
Πώς ο Ερατοσθένης υπολόγισε την περιφέρεια της Γης πάνω από 2000 χρόνια πριν;
Τι θα γινόταν αν ο αυτισμός ήταν ... υπερδύναμη;
Εκπληκτικές φωτογραφίες του Cassini λίγο πριν τη συντριβή του στον Κρόνο